Grave Care Basics: Preservation through Cleaning

at Confederate Memorial State Historic Site

5/16/2026 | Confederate Memorial State Historic Site | Higginsville, Mo.

Representatives from the State Historic Preservation Office will present a grave preservation workshop at Confederate Memorial State Historic Site on Saturday, May 16. This free, hands-on event will take place at the historic site's Confederate Home Cemetery. The workshop is open to anyone who is interested in preserving a piece of local history while learning how to clean historic headstones in a safe, effective and respectful manner. 

Instructors will provide information about which tools and cleaning solutions to use -- and which ones to avoid -- while also sharing general preservation tips. Cleaning solution, brushes, gloves and safety glasses will be provided. Participants should wear comfortable clothing and shoes that can get dirty. They are also encouraged to bring drinking water, sunglasses, sunscreen, insect repellent, hats, kneeling pads and camp chairs. Space for the workshop is limited, and online registration is required.
